Kodak Touch vs Nikon S1100pj Overview
Here is a in depth overview of the Kodak Touch vs Nikon S1100pj, both Ultracompact digital cameras by manufacturers Kodak and Nikon. The resolution of the Touch (14MP) and the S1100pj (14MP) is very similar but the Touch (1/3") and S1100pj (1/2.3") use totally different sensor sizes.

The Touch was brought out 5 months later than the S1100pj which means that they are both of a similar generation. Both cameras offer the identical body type (Ultracompact).

Kodak Touch vs Nikon S1100pj Physical Comparison
If you're intending to carry your camera frequently, you'll need to think about its weight and size. The Kodak Touch features exterior dimensions of 101mm x 58mm x 19mm (4.0" x 2.3" x 0.7") along with a weight of 150 grams (0.33 lbs) while the Nikon S1100pj has specifications of 101mm x 68mm x 24mm (4.0" x 2.7" x 0.9") with a weight of 180 grams (0.40 lbs).

Kodak Touch vs Nikon S1100pj Sensor Comparison
Generally, it's difficult to visualise the difference between sensor sizing simply by reading technical specs. The photograph below should provide you a far better sense of the sensor dimensions in the Touch and S1100pj.
As you have seen, both of these cameras enjoy the same exact MP but not the same sensor sizing. The Touch has got the tinier sensor which is going to make getting shallower DOF more difficult.
